Alan,
Unfortunately I think you've run in to the biggest drawback with these kind of specialized graphics processors as used in Hades Canyon. AMD is constantly updating their drivers based on developer feedback, but those updates take time to filter down to our devices. As you noticed, the official 8809G graphics driver is based on AMD's Adrenalin 18.7.1 release, which is a few months old. AMD now has Adrenalin 18.9.1 available.
We are at the mercy of Intel repackaging the AMD drivers for use with the 8809G, and keeping them updated and in sync with AMD. Sadly for us, we have no idea when (or even if) Intel will update the official graphics driver. For what it's worth, Apple bootcamp users have this same issue with needing Apple to repackage and build official AMD drivers for their unique graphics solutions.
All we can do really is wait and hope Intel updates the drivers soon...

Hello Alan_J_T,
Usually Software and Driver tools only provide validated drivers since this is the recommended method for the general public.
Typically, BETA drivers are manually installed since the supplier usually does not provide any support, only receives feedback.
In this case, I will provide your recommendation to the support team.
